A gym instructor has celebrated 20 years teaching a Jazzercise class by holding a charity fundraiser in Royston.
More than 50 people attended the charity event held by fitness trainer Linda Warner - raising £800 for Breakthrough Breast Cancer and Motor Neurone Disease Association.
Linda said: “I can’t believe I’ve been teaching the same class for 20 years.
“I’ve met so many people coming through the door who have turned into friends I’ll have for life.
“I couldn’t do it without their support. It’s not just about the exercise.”
Linda runs a Jazzercise class on Tuesdays at 6.15pm and 7pm and Thursdays 6.40pm and 7.30pm at The Greneway School on Garden Walk. Linda welcomes newcomers and recommends they come early.
Jazzercise is a dance based fitness program featuring jazz dance, resistance training, pilates and yoga.
